The Mountain Heritage Cougars are taking a road trip to challenge the Madison Patriots at 5:00 p.m. on Tuesday. The squads are rolling into the game with opposing streaks: Mountain Heritage has struggled recently with four losses in a row, while Madison will arrive with three straight wins.
Friday just wasn't the day for Mountain Heritage's offense. They lost 15-0 to Owen on Friday.
Meanwhile, winning is always nice, but doing so behind a season-high score is even better (just ask Madison). Everything went their way against Avery County on Friday as Madison made off with a 17-2 victory. The result was nothing new for the Patriots, who have now won three matches by ten runs or more so far this season.
Rylee Plemmons made a big impact no matter where she played. She looked comfortable on the mound, striking out eight batters over four innings while giving up just two earned runs off two hits. Those eight strikeouts gave her a new career-high. She was also stellar in the batter's box, scoring two runs and stealing a base while going 1-for-3. She also hit a double, marking her first of the season.
In other batting news, Kylee Ball was incredible, getting on base in all four of her plate appearances with two runs, one triple, and one stolen base. That triple was her first of the season. Another player making a difference was Paige Peek, who scored two runs and stole a base while going 1-for-3.
Madison was getting hits left and right and finished the game having posted a batting average of .423. That was just more of the same: they've now posted a batting average of .423 or higher in three consecutive contests.
Mountain Heritage's defeat dropped their record down to 0-3. As for Madison, they now have a winning record of 3-2.
Mountain Heritage couldn't quite get it done against Madison in their previous meeting back in April of 2024 as they fell 6-2. Can Mountain Heritage avenge their loss or is history doomed to repeat itself? We'll find out soon enough.
